The Twilights – Once Upon a Twilight (1968)

Once Upon a Twilight is a 1968 concept album by Australian beat combo The Twilights. The album culminated from months of painstaking work by the band’s mastermind Terry Britten. The band split soon afterwards when the guitarist/writer scored a gig with Cliff Richard, who covered the track “Take Action” on his 1969 Sincerely LP. Tracklist: […]

Blood, Sweat & Tears – Child Is Father to the Man (1968)

Child Is Father to the Man is the debut album by American jazz-rock septet Blood, Sweat & Tears, released in 1968 on Columbia. The album is the band’s only release to feature trumpeter Randy Brecker and keyboardist/vocalist Al Kooper.
